ABSTRACT:
A light source capable of producing intermittent flashes of light is used as a light source for illuminating an original. The light source is triggered in response to the read signal and a self-scanning type array of light receptors accumulates the charge representative of a light image focused thereon. In synchronism with the triggering of the light source, the video output is derived from memory means which stores the charge thus accumulated.
